Transaction 2518a423435a2c0556c719566c65f3f03a42455264d1c37a47977fc41033fe87
1 Input
2 Outputs
- 2518a423435a2c0556c719566c65f3f03a42455264d1c37a47977fc41033fe87:0
- 2518a423435a2c0556c719566c65f3f03a42455264d1c37a47977fc41033fe87:1
value 770900
address 3CKiHnVoHGuVDSpQBFSBypSWxciPcvJ8J9
value 34437799
address 1GVoaLWJqvs38XUSU5vj3sqCTV26ND6Vwe